Grant Description

The Western Indian Ocean’s rich ecosystems generate over $20.8bn annually, yet face rapid degradation, threatening coastal communities.

This project pilots an innovative seascape financing model in Tanzania’s RUMAKI seascape, a UNESCO Biosphere Reserve, to support 28,000 people through sustainable blue economy livelihoods.
